What Are Your Rewards for Reaching Your Goal?

All my rewards are fitness related. I got myself new running shoes for losing 10 pounds. I'll get a HRM for the next 10 lost. Heavier weights for the 10 after that. And new workout clothes once I've lost 40 pounds.
